18#
19# This test acts as a series of regression tests in DTrace around
20# printing bitfields that are byte sized at non-byte aligned offsets and
21# around printing fields that are less than a byte in size, but due to their
22# offset, cross a byte boundary (e.g. a 5-bit bitfield that starts at
23# bit 6).
24#
25# The DTrace implementation has two different general paths for this:
26#
27#  o The D compiler compiling a dereference into DIF code to be executed
28#    in probe context to extract a bitfield value.
29#  o The print() action which grabs the larger chunk of memory and then
30#    processes it all in userland.
31#
